AEPA (Association Of Educational Purchasing Agencies)
What is AEPA (Association Of Educational Purchasing Agencies)?
The Association of Educational Purchasing Agencies (AEPA) is a multi-state non-profit organization that creates cooperative purchasing contracts for educational entities. As a government contractor, understanding AEPA can open up opportunities to provide goods and services to a large network of schools, universities, and other educational institutions across multiple states.
Definition
AEPA leverages the collective buying power of its member educational agencies to negotiate competitively bid contracts. These contracts cover a wide range of products and services commonly used in the education sector, including classroom supplies, technology, furniture, and facility maintenance. The legal basis for AEPA's operation lies in the various state laws that allow for cooperative purchasing agreements between government entities. For government contractors, AEPA represents a consolidated marketplace, simplifying the process of reaching numerous educational customers through a single contract vehicle.
Key Points
- Multi-State Reach: AEPA contracts offer access to educational institutions across multiple states, expanding market reach.
- Competitive Bidding: AEPA contracts are awarded through a rigorous competitive bidding process, ensuring fair and transparent procurement.
- Simplified Procurement: Educational entities benefit from streamlined procurement processes, reducing administrative burden.
- Reduced Costs: The collective buying power of AEPA members results in lower pricing for products and services.
Practical Examples
- Technology Solutions: A technology company providing educational software could bid on an AEPA contract, allowing schools in several states to easily purchase and implement their product.
- Furniture for Classrooms: A furniture manufacturer could secure an AEPA contract, enabling schools to furnish classrooms with pre-approved, competitively priced furniture options.
- Janitorial Services: A cleaning company could offer janitorial services through an AEPA contract, providing a cost-effective solution for maintaining school facilities.
